Androgen means a necessary hormone that promotes the maturation of male accessory organs and secondary sexual characteristics. It can maintain normal male sexual desire and male reproductive function. Androgen is mainly composed of testosterone secreted by the testicles. It is a steroid hormone. Adult males secrete 4 to 9 mg of testosterone every day. Testosterone is inactivated in the liver, and the inactivated derivatives can be excreted through urine. Cause Androgens are mainly produced in the testicles of male animals, and the adrenal cortex also secretes a small amount of androgens. The original hormone isolated from testicular tissue is called testosterone, which has the functions of promoting the formation of male reproductive organs, the development of secondary sexual characteristics and promoting protein assimilation. Androgens are regulated by the pituitary gland and hypothalamus. There is a complex relationship of mutual connection and mutual restraint between the hypothalamus, pituitary gland and gonadal hormones. Together, they participate in the control and regulation of reproductive activities, which is called the hypothalamic-pituitary-gonadal axis. The main male hormone is testosterone, 95% of which is secreted by interstitial cells of the testicles and 5% by the adrenal glands. Androgens play a very important role in the generation of male sexual desire and the maintenance of sexual function, but they are not the only factor in maintaining sexual desire and sexual function in adults. Men's testosterone levels change rhythmically over a 24-hour period, being highest in the morning and lowest in the evening. Although men often have erections in the morning, sexual activity peaks at night. It seems that human sexual desire is not only related to hormones, but also restricted by other factors. Physiological effects 1. Fetal impact The physiological effects of androgens already exist during the fetal period. Testosterone in androgens can promote the differentiation of gonadal structure. The male internal and external genitalia are formed under its action. On the contrary, if the fetus lacks testosterone or the amount of testosterone is insufficient, the fetus's sexual organs will be deformed or underdeveloped, such as cryptorchidism. 2. Secondary Sexual Characteristics Sexual physiological development includes the development of primary sexual characteristics (such as the development of sexual reproductive organs) and secondary sexual characteristics (such as the development of body appearance). The role of androgen in promoting the development of primary sexual characteristics includes promoting the enlargement of testicles and the thickness of penis, etc.; the role of secondary sexual characteristics includes promoting the appearance of body hair, voice change, and prominent Adam's apple, etc. If there is no male hormone or the secretion of male hormone is too low, the development of sexual organs and the appearance of secondary sexual characteristics will be delayed, and even physical abnormalities may occur. 3. Sexual function Androgens stimulate sexual desire and increase sexual excitement by affecting the sexual nerve center and stimulating the reproductive organs. If there is no or too little male hormone, a person's sexual desire will decrease, and it is easy to cause sexual dysfunction such as impotence. Testosterone deficiency can lead to a decline in overall health in middle-aged and older men, including decreased libido, depression, fatigue and erectile dysfunction. Studies have shown that the lower a man's testosterone level, the greater the likelihood of developing metabolic syndrome, which in turn leads to diabetes, heart disease, cardiovascular disease, and even erectile dysfunction. 5.
